📜  Kali Linux-维护访问权限(1)

📅  最后修改于: 2023-12-03 15:17:07.814000             🧑  作者: Mango

Kali Linux-维护访问权限

Kali Linux是一个流行的渗透测试和安全审计的开源操作系统。在这个系统中,维护访问权限是一个非常关键的任务。在此,我们将介绍如何使用一些命令来维护Kali Linux中的访问权限。

检查文件的权限

在Kali Linux中,使用ls -l命令可以列出文件的详细权限。下面是一个简单的示例:

$ ls -l /etc/passwd
-rw-r--r-- 1 root root 2468 Jul 31 08:39 /etc/passwd

在这个ls -l的输出中,第一列显示了文件的权限。在这个示例中,文件/etc/passwd的权限为-rw-r--r--。这意味着文件的所有者(root用户)有读写权限,其他用户只有读权限。通过这种方式,您可以检查文件的权限,并根据需要更改它们。

更改文件权限

要更改文件或目录的权限,可以使用chmod命令。该命令使用数字或符号方式来更改文件权限。

数字方式

数字方式更改权限是通过octal(八进制)数字来执行的。可以使用以下数字来表示不同的权限:

  • 0:没有访问权限
  • 1:执行权限
  • 2:写权限
  • 4:读权限

例如,要将文件file.txt的权限更改为rw-r-----,可以使用以下命令:

$ chmod 640 file.txt

这样,文件所有者将有读写权限,组用户将有读权限,其他用户没有访问权限。

符号方式

符号方式更改权限是使用以下符号来执行的:

  • +添加权限
  • -移除权限
  • =批量设置权限

例如,以下命令将更改文件file.txt的权限:

$ chmod u+rwx,g-x,o-rwx file.txt

在这个命令中,u表示所有者,g表示组,o表示其他用户。+rwx将为该用户添加读、写和执行权限。-x将删除该组执行权限。-rwx删除其他用户的读、写和执行权限。

更改文件所有者和用户组

使用chown命令可以更改文件或目录的所有者和用户组。例如,将文件file.txt的所有者更改为用户nancy,用户组更改为staff,可以使用以下命令:

$ sudo chown nancy:staff file.txt

在这个命令中,sudo提供管理员权限,nancy是文件的新所有者名称,staff是新的用户组名称,file.txt是要更改的文件名称。

结论

维护访问权限是保护Kali Linux安全的重要方面。使用ls -lchmod命令可以检查和更改文件权限。使用chown命令可以更改文件或目录的所有者和用户组。